I think I have solved the FMV problem on my HD2...

If you load a state (with the supporter version), you will have a grey screen and NO video.

But if you load from MEMORY CARD, you will have sound, and THEN only you can load from a state (supporter version) and HAVE the videos !


Something is still wrong with the Load / Save state of the supporter version.
